Foyle Valley House is a female hostel accommodation giving support and care for up to 14 homeless women who have an alcohol dependency. It is situated close to the city centre of Derry~Londonderry. Foyle Valley House provides a comfortable and safe home with 24-hour staff support services, 365 days a year.
